Mary’s Place provides safe and inclusive shelter and services for women, children, and families on their journey out of homelessness. We operate a women’s day center and several 24/7 family shelters throughout King County. We serve hundreds of families each year, providing a safe place to stay, nutritious meals, essential services, and access to housing and employment resources. We believe that no one’s child should sleep outside.

The HR & Benefits Administrator is a key member of the Human Resources team, providing administrative and operational support across the employee lifecycle with a specialized focus on benefits administration, payroll support, leave and accommodation management, HR compliance, employee records administration, and customer service. This position serves as an important liaison between employees, managers, HR, Payroll, and third-party benefit providers to ensure accurate and timely administration of employee programs and employment-related processes.

The HR & Benefits Administrator manages employee leaves of absence and accommodations, supports payroll and benefits administration, maintains HR records and compliance activities, and assists with recruitment, onboarding, offboarding, and employee communications. This role requires exceptional attention to detail, strong organizational skills, a high degree of confidentiality, and a commitment to providing outstanding service to employees.
